The “Gemstone in the Sky” at CreekStone Cabins Plus is a lofty 2 bedroom, 2 bath private dwelling with many outdoor activities on site such as fire pit, horseshoes, corn hole, hiking/walking trails and more. Open floor plan with full size well furnished kitchen with island and separate dining area. Living room has sofa that converts to full size bed, love seat and TV. Both bathrooms are spacious and both have double sinks. The space underneath the Gemstone is only used for storage which means the home is only occupied by you. The old restored barn on property is a great place to relax and enjoy family games. The Gemstone has a private deck with seating area and a grill. This property was my childhood home and after retirement I moved back to the home on the property that my Dad built. My Dad also built the old red barn where the loft has been outfitted with games and spaces to relax and is shared by all my guests. We wanted to offer this space for guests to share in the awesome mountain views and enjoy a quiet relaxing place to unwind. In addition to the lofty apartment we also have the Farmhouse (also listed on VRBO) as well as 3 campsites, all with their unique spaces.
